Tyler , on a real 1 : O-rings with backup rings and a wiper seal . For what we do just an o-ring . Real 1's use chrome rods (polished) thats what you want to have . I use 304 L ss from online metals . From the mill it comes very smooth . Another issue could be your piston seals are too tight . Looking at you ram pics , def. too course . I should note , if your cap (gland) is cocked in the slightest way that will make it leak also .
